Choosing the Right Tools for Network Automation

Selecting appropriate solutions for network management can be a complex process. You'll want to evaluate factors such as the scope of your network , your present skillset, and financial constraints . Widely used options feature Python with libraries like Ansible, Netmiko, and Paramiko, alongside enterprise offerings with vendors including Cisco and Juniper. In the end, the most effective choice depends on a specific needs and priorities .
